Job Description

We’re building Mo — a health companion for everyone. We’re a small team within Alan, on a mission to redefine the future of care by democratizing access to medical expertise. We are building Mo, an intelligent, empathetic, multimodal LLM-based conversational AI assistant able to prescribe, triage, and proactively follow up on care. Imagine giving every person in the world instant, 24/7 access to personalised medical expertise - through chat, voice, or video. That’s what we are building. We kicked off the project in 2023. After a strong R&D phase, we’re now scaling Mo to our entire French portfolio (1M members), and then our other countries.
